[gnome-shell] shell-global: remove "gratuitous" meta_plugin_* calls
- From: Dan Winship <danw src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gnome-shell] shell-global: remove "gratuitous" meta_plugin_* calls
- Date: Wed, 3 Aug 2011 13:14:03 +0000 (UTC)
commit 7765d6a08f8b9b8358ce001c3b79d76025a9a40e
Author: Dan Winship <danw gnome org>
Date: Thu Mar 24 16:12:33 2011 -0400
shell-global: remove "gratuitous" meta_plugin_* calls
MetaPlugin wraps a bunch of compositor (and plain metacity) methods
that we can just call ourselves, so just do that. (Presumably this
dates back to some ancient time when it was imagined that plugins
wouldn't need access to the full metacity API.)
https://bugzilla.gnome.org/show_bug.cgi?id=654639
src/shell-global.c | 12 ++++++------
1 files changed, 6 insertions(+), 6 deletions(-)
---
diff --git a/src/shell-global.c b/src/shell-global.c
index 3370b42..ac588d2 100644
--- a/src/shell-global.c
+++ b/src/shell-global.c
@@ -153,7 +153,7 @@ shell_global_get_property(GObject *object,
switch (prop_id)
{
case PROP_OVERLAY_GROUP:
- g_value_set_object (value, meta_plugin_get_overlay_group (global->plugin));
+ g_value_set_object (value, meta_get_overlay_group_for_screen (global->meta_screen));
break;
case PROP_SCREEN:
g_value_set_object (value, global->meta_screen);
@@ -168,7 +168,7 @@ shell_global_get_property(GObject *object,
{
int width, height;
- meta_plugin_query_screen_size (global->plugin, &width, &height);
+ meta_screen_get_size (global->meta_screen, &width, &height);
g_value_set_int (value, width);
}
break;
@@ -176,7 +176,7 @@ shell_global_get_property(GObject *object,
{
int width, height;
- meta_plugin_query_screen_size (global->plugin, &width, &height);
+ meta_screen_get_size (global->meta_screen, &width, &height);
g_value_set_int (value, height);
}
break;
@@ -187,10 +187,10 @@ shell_global_get_property(GObject *object,
g_value_set_enum (value, global->input_mode);
break;
case PROP_WINDOW_GROUP:
- g_value_set_object (value, meta_plugin_get_window_group (global->plugin));
+ g_value_set_object (value, meta_get_window_group_for_screen (global->meta_screen));
break;
case PROP_BACKGROUND_ACTOR:
- g_value_set_object (value, meta_plugin_get_background_actor (global->plugin));
+ g_value_set_object (value, meta_get_background_actor_for_screen (global->meta_screen));
break;
case PROP_WINDOW_MANAGER:
g_value_set_object (value, global->wm);
@@ -702,7 +702,7 @@ shell_global_get_window_actors (ShellGlobal *global)
{
g_return_val_if_fail (SHELL_IS_GLOBAL (global), NULL);
- return meta_plugin_get_window_actors (global->plugin);
+ return meta_get_window_actors (global->meta_screen);
}
static void
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]